Analysis
The most recent figure for united states of america — veneer sheets — export value in Thailand is 27 1000 USD, measured in 2017.
The figure is down 94.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, united states of america — veneer sheets — export value in Thailand peaked at 986 1000 USD in 1998 and was at its lowest, 14 1000 USD, in 2010.
Thailand ranks 61st of 74 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
